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of enterprise team management technology, specifically to a team work area unit. Background Technology

[0002] As the basic unit of an enterprise, the work team is the most basic organizational unit engaged in production, operation, service, or management. Currently, enterprises are actively strengthening the construction of grassroots work teams, aiming to provide continuous impetus for their work and development through a scientific and comprehensive management system. An excellent work team not only needs efficient management systems but also needs to build and promote a unified corporate culture and handle a large number of daily business and training tasks.

[0003] However, many current team activity spaces are limited to posting promotional materials on workshop walls or setting up display windows. This approach has many shortcomings. Existing team activity spaces lack unified standards and norms, making it difficult to achieve consistent and systematic dissemination of corporate culture. Traditional team activity spaces mainly focus on information display and fail to effectively undertake the task of organizing training and learning, thus failing to meet the needs of team members for skill improvement. Due to the lack of a systematic management and supervision mechanism, the relevant requirements for team building are often not strictly enforced, affecting the improvement of overall management level. Existing team activity spaces fail to provide team members with a warm working environment and a strong sense of collective belonging, which is not conducive to the formation of team cohesion.

[0004] In addition, the team activity area is located inside the workshop. The team activity area needs to be flexibly adjusted according to changes in production tasks. Its construction must be easy to set up. The existing team activity area cannot meet the management and production needs of the enterprise.

[0005] Therefore, existing technologies need further development. Utility Model Content

[0034] In the team / group corner unit of this embodiment, see Figure 1 , Figure 5-6 The roof panel assembly 2 is composed of a roof panel frame 21 and crossbeams 22. There are multiple crossbeams 22, and each crossbeam 22 is detachably connected to the roof panel frame 21. By setting multiple crossbeams 22, the relatively empty roof panel assembly 2 is filled. The number, spacing, and arrangement of the crossbeams 22 should be carefully designed to achieve visual balance and harmony, so that the roof panel assembly 2 is aesthetically pleasing.

[0035] In the team / group corner unit of this embodiment, see Figure 1 , Figure 5-6The top plate frame 21 includes multiple vertical beams 211, which are spaced apart along a first preset direction. The top plate assembly 2 includes lifting components 4, each hollowly provided with a connecting groove 44, which houses a horizontal beam 22. The lifting components 4 are fixedly mounted on the vertical beams 211. Multiple lifting components 4 are spaced apart along the extension direction of the vertical beams 211, and the extension direction of the horizontal beams 22 is perpendicular to the extension direction of the vertical beams 211. By using multiple lifting components 4, the horizontal beams 22 can be hoisted onto the top plate, facilitating their installation and disassembly, while also providing a certain degree of aesthetic appeal and lower manufacturing costs.

[0036] In the team / group corner unit of this embodiment, see Figure 1 , Figure 5-6 The hoisting component 4 includes: a first connecting part 41, one end of which is connected to the vertical beam 211; a second connecting part 42, one end of which is connected to the first connecting part 41, and the other end of which is connected to a third connecting part 43; and a third connecting part 43, the end of which is away from the second connecting part 42, which is connected to the crossbeam 22. The first connecting part 41, the second connecting part 42, and the third connecting part 43 form a connecting groove 44. This facilitates the installation and disassembly of the crossbeam 22 and makes it easy to remove the crossbeam 22.

[0037] In some embodiments, the first connecting portion 41 and the third connecting portion 43 are respectively provided with a certain included angle with the second connecting portion 42, so as to facilitate the crossbeam 22 to pass through the connecting groove 44. In some embodiments, the first connecting portion 41 and the third connecting portion 43 are respectively perpendicular to the second connecting portion 42.

[0038] In the team / group corner unit of this embodiment, see Figure 3 The top slab frame 21 includes: a base frame 212, which is connected to multiple walls on its periphery, and multiple vertical beams 211 are fixedly installed on the base frame 212; and a reinforcing beam 213, which extends perpendicularly to the vertical beams 211, and includes at least one reinforcing beam 213, which is centrally located on the base frame 212. Thus, by setting up the vertical beams 211, the base frame 212, and the base frame 212, the structural strength of the top slab frame 21 is fully guaranteed.

[0039] Specifically, the vertical beam 211, the foundation frame 212, and the foundation frame 212 are all composed of multiple short profiles, and the intersecting profiles are connected by screws and bolts.

[0040] In the team / group corner unit of this embodiment, see Figure 2The display panel frame 1 includes: a frame body 11, which is hollow inside to accommodate a first display panel, the first display panel being detachably connected to the frame body 11; an upper connecting column 12, located above the frame body 11, with one end connected to the frame body 11 and the other end connected to the wall frame 5; and a lower connecting column 13, located below the frame body 11, with one end connected to the frame body 11 and the other end connected to the wall frame 5. This configuration is used to install the first display panel, and the display panel frame 1 can also form a pattern, providing aesthetic appeal.

[0041] In some embodiments, the upper connecting column 12 and the lower connecting column 13 each include two columns, and the upper connecting column 12 and the lower connecting column 13 are connected to the frame body 11 by screws.

[0042] In some embodiments, the first display panel is fixed to the frame body 11 by screws, and the frame body 11 is provided with screw holes, through which screws are connected to the first display panel.

[0043] In the team / group corner unit of this embodiment, see Figure 2 The wall frame 5 includes: a wall base frame 51; wall columns 52, centrally located on the wall base frame 51; a first support column 53 and a second support column 54, spaced apart, with their extension directions perpendicular to the wall columns 52. The ends of the first and second support columns 53 and 54 are connected to the wall columns 52 and the wall base frame 51, respectively. The height of the second support column 54 corresponds to that of the cabinet 3. Thus, the various components of the wall frame 5 are connected by screws, ensuring the structural strength of the wall frame 5.

[0044] Specifically, the top of the upper connecting column 12 is connected to the first support column 53, and the bottom of the lower connecting column 13 is connected to the second support column 54. Therefore, the first support column 53 and the second support column 54 can be used to install the display board frame 1.

[0045] In the team / group corner unit of this embodiment, see Figure 1The walls consist of the following sequentially connected components: a first wall 61, with an entrance / exit passage 65; a second wall 62, with a display panel frame 1 mounted on it; a third wall 63, opposite to the first wall 61, with an internal display window 631; and a fourth wall 64, opposite to the second wall 62, also with a display panel frame 1 mounted on it. Thus, the work group's work area unit has a square structure, with the first wall 61, second wall 62, third wall 63, and fourth wall 64 collectively enclosing and forming the work group's work area.

[0046] It should be noted that the third wall 63 is generally placed against the wall, so a full-wall display area, i.e., an internal display window 631, can be set up here. It can be used to display the work results of the work team, promote corporate culture, etc. The internal display window 631 can not only be used as a display area, but also to install a monitor. The monitor can be used to display the progress and completion status of workshop production tasks.

[0047] In some embodiments, a back panel can be provided in the internal display window 631 to hold display boards or displays. The display boards can be glued to the back panel or magnetically attached to the back panel, making it easy to replace the display boards.

[0048] In the team / group corner unit of this embodiment, see Figure 1 On both sides of the entrance / exit passage 65, there are first external display windows 611 and second external display windows 612, respectively. Each external display window 611 and 612 contains a mounting plate made of transparent material, on which external display panels are mounted. Thus, by setting up the first external display windows 611 and 612, the work group's display area can be used for external display. The use of transparent mounting plates also enhances the aesthetics of the first and second external display windows 611 and 612. The display panels can be glued to the mounting plates or magnetically attached to the back panel.

[0049] In the team / group corner unit of this embodiment, see Figure 1 Multiple walls have a third display panel 7 installed at one end near the top panel assembly 2, and the third display panel 7 extends along the length of the wall. In this way, a display area is also set at the top of each wall, and the third display panel 7 can be used to display promotional slogans or promote corporate culture, etc.

[0050] Specifically, the first support column 53 and the top plate assembly 2 form an installation area for the third display panel 7. The third display panel 7 can be a different color from the main structure of the work group garden unit, further enhancing the aesthetics of the work group garden unit.
